Transaction 07e03f5a61133d22df85150db55a76539551389a1c1f75df5e9f08579018f299
1 Input
1 Output
-
07e03f5a61133d22df85150db55a76539551389a1c1f75df5e9f08579018f299:0
- value
- 1309763
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ec4debd4046b17e515f37edfb65f7c25e3e83be
- address
- bc1qpmzda02qg6chu52lxlklke0hcf0raqa7x2j4eq